Unless you are going around Christmas, especially Christmas Eve, theres no rush to make the reservations when they first come out at 7:00am. It's not like CRT, it willn't sellout in a few minutes (Christmas Eve does go fast). I have called a couple days after they came out and have always got my first choice (for early December).
